Released in 2001, Goal Club is an action, thriller, drama and crime film directed by Kittikorn Liasirikun, running about 97 minutes. “One rule to win every game "cheat".” — that tagline sets the tone.
What it’s about. A group of teens gets involved in the underground football betting scene where lots of money can be quickly won or lost.
Who’s in it. Goal Club stars Akarin Akaranitimaytharatt as Otto, Wongwarut Tontrakul as Ngoun, Prinya Ngamwongwarn as Bank and Khensanut Hammerling as Nay, among others.
